Discover the BALI 4.1

 The Bali 4.1 is the perfectly designed Charter Catamaran and will guarantee a comfortable, fun exploration of French Polynesia.  Our Bali 4.1 can be set up for three or four cabins depending on your needs. 


Relaxation : Sailing and fun in Lounge mode

  • A forward cockpit with dining area as well as an immense sunbathing area in place of the traditional trampoline
  • Extra living space with sunbathing area on the roof
  • New bench seating in the aft cockpit


Comfort : The Bali 4.1 offers L-shaped dining area and a new interior design
The BALI 4.1’s nacelle, completely free from bulkheads, comprises a very comfortable L-shaped dining area which faces across to an extendable lounger. The galley unit creates unrivalled storage volume and worktop area.
The interior décor, by Lasta Design Studio, puts the emphasis on light, ergonomics, fluid shapes and the finest materials.


Practical : 

  • The vast cockpit / saloon area, which completely opens up with a huge pivoting glazed door.
  • The very seaworthy integral foredeck area that provides rigidity and protection from spray with a very large sunbathing area and a forward cockpit which can comfortably accommodate the whole crew.
  • The raised helm station and very convivial flybridge.
  • Retracting or sliding windows for optimal ventilation both at sea and at anchor.
  • Water and diesel tankage, and cool capacity superior to those of all their competitors.


                        Navigation electronics and other equipment standard on our Bali 4.1-


Ray Marine Electronics

Helm station mapping

HiFi, 2 square HP, 2 HP cockpit

Annex and survival Zodiac annex 3m40 8 people with outboard engine Mercury 15 hp 2-stroke
Four double cabins:

  • 2 rear with bed 2.00 m x 1.60 m
  • 2 front with bed 2.00 m x 1.56 m to 0.9 m (trapezoid)

Square table convertible into a bunk and mattress
2 bathrooms with toilet and sink
Large volume refrigerator, cigarette lighter socket, hot water tank 40 liters
Oven, sink double stainless steel tray

Converter 220 V

Water maker 60 L/h

Exterior and Rigging

Bimini, Lazy bag, lazy jack.

Trolling/Fishing  equipment - Shimano 130

2 Rotopol single-seat kayaks

Solar panels
